US Charges Chinese Salesman with Illegally Exporting Nuclear Equipment

Posted May 23rd, 2012 at 8:50 pm (UTC-5)
Leave a comment

U.S. authorities have arrested a Chinese employee of a technology manufacturer for allegedly smuggling uranium enrichment equipment into China. Agents arrested Qiang Hu at a hotel in the northeastern state of Massachusetts.
